How they compare
Madagascar currently reports -2,579 number against -2,608 number in North Macedonia, a difference of 29 number.
The two have swapped places 4 times across 15 shared years of data; in 1999 it was Madagascar ahead.
Madagascar ranks 79th and North Macedonia ranks 80th of 136 countries.
Across the 3 decades both report, Madagascar averaged higher in 2 and North Macedonia in 1.

About this data
Number of tertiary students from abroad (inbound students) studying in a given country minus the number of students at the same level from a given country studying abroad (outbound students).
